English 3 Connections Make the following connection to use this product. Connecting to a TV Connect the product to TV via HDMI jack to view the playback from the disc. Connect to the HDMI Jack HDMI IN 1. Connect a HDMI cable from the HDMI output jack on this product to the HDMI input jack on the TV. Note: - You can optimize the video output by pressing the HDMI button repeatedly to select the best resolution which the TV can support. Optional Connection Option 1: Connect to the digital amplifier/ receiver Option 2: Connect to network Option 3: Connect to Wifi Option 1: Connect to the digital amplifier/receiver Route the sound from this player to other device to enhance audio output. DIGITAL AUDIO INPUT COAXIAL 1. Connect a coaxial cable from the COAXIAL jack on this product to the COAXIAL jack on the device. Option 2: Connect to network Connect this product to the network to enjoy BD-LiveTM bonus content and software upgrade by network. 1. Connect the network cable from the LAN jack on the product to the LAN jack on the network system. Option 3: Connect to Wifi Connect the TOSHIBA's USB Wi-Fi® adapter to the USB jack on the front panel of the Blu-ray Disc™ player, and set the wireless network options. No physical connection to the wireless router is necessary. wireless access point Wireless LAN Adapter 1. Configure your player to access the wireless access point or router. 2. The network configuration and connection method may vary depending on the equipment in use and the network environment. Your Blu-ray Disc™ player is equipped with an IEEE 802.11n wireless module, which also supports the 802.11 a/b/g/n standards. For the best wireless performance, we recommend using an IEEE 802.11n certified Wi-Fi® network (access point or wireless router).
